Using stem cells, Doris Taylor brought the heart of a dead animal back to life and might one day revolutionize human organ transplantation. She takes us beyond lightning rod issues and into an unfolding frontier where science is learning how stem cells work reparatively in every body at every age.
Episode 211 of the On Being with Krista Tippett podcast, hosted by On Being Studios, titled "Doris Taylor — Stem Cells, Untold Stories" was published on September 30, 2010 and runs 51 minutes.
